今回は初期化について勉強するよ。いつものように始めに動画をみてね。
初期化というのは、プログラムを開始する前に変数の中身を一度、お掃除して値をリセットすること(最初に入れたい値を入れなおす)作業だよ。
初期化をちゃんと行っていないと、直前にプログラム動かした時の値が変数の中に残ったままなので、思っていたのと違う結果になっちゃうよ。この例では前回の結果「10」が変数の中に入っているから、敵を倒していないのに10点ももらえているという変な状態となっているんだ。
だから、初期化という処理を最初にいれて、変数の中をキレイにして正しい値にセットしなおしてあげることが重要なんだ。
なれている人がプログラムを作っても、なんか動作が変だなと思ったら、この初期化処理を忘れていたということも結構あるので、あなどれないよ。
次回はフローチャートについて説明するね。
Scratchで学ぶプログラミング基礎の一覧はこちら
Scratchでまなぶプログラミングの基本
このブログはプログラミングがはじめてな人、子供こどもにプログラミングを教おしえる親向おやむけに発信はっしんするというコンセプトで書かいていたのですが、小学生向しょうがくせいむけにやさしく説明せつめいした記事きじもあっていいよねと。 こ...
コメント